The Global
Warming Alliance Ltd is a not-for-profit company.
We are
a research and campaigning group whose objectives are to deepen the
understanding of climate change and promote ways to minimise the global
impact.
We seek
to draw together the many disparate companies, research bodies and individuals
who are engaged in finding solutions to the fundamental changes taking
place on the earth and in the atmosphere surrounding it.
Our funds
are principally directed towards atmospheric research and to raising
awareness both internationally and locally in the United Kingdom of
possible policy options.
We seek
pragmatic solutions and endorse industrial initiatives of a viable nature
as well as individual efforts to stabilise climate change in order to
arrive at a balanced formula for the continuance of human life on the
planet.
We acknowledge
that adjustments will not be easy and will use our scientific advisors
resource to put forward science based but sensible solutions.
